Leia e fale com a mesma rapidez da gravação. Tente pronunciar os "schwas" corretamente. I haven't got a very big family, just one younger brother, Ricardo. He's quite tall and dark like me. He works as a taxi-driver. Ricardo's single and, as far as I know, he hasn't got a girlfriend at the moment. My dad's name's Eduardo. He's the manager at a social project in a favela in Rio - I think the word is 'shanty town' in English. He's fifty-eight, not very tall and he's getting a bit fat now. He's going bald too which he hates! My mum's a primary school teacher. Her name's Angelica and she's fifty-two years old. She's really slim with long straight hair and green eyes. Thiago's tall, dark and handsome of course! He's got short, curly hair and gorgeous eyes. They were the first thing I noticed about him. And me, well, I look like my father except I've got a lot more hair! Oh and we don't have any pets. When I was a child I had two dogs called Toby and Jumbo. I miss them. Study Tip
. If you find it difficult speaking with the recording, don't give up! This will help you with the rhythm and sounds of English, and you'll get faster with practice. . Schwas represent about 30% of the unstressed vowel sounds in spoken English - that's one in three of all unstressed vowels! . The best way to say them correctly is: - to identify and say the stressed parts of phrases strongly and - then say the rest quickly and with less force, which will allow you to make the necessary reductions.
